libInit.cc
changeset 29 443911ff729a
parent 24 f07f2a2a8148
--- a/libInit.cc	Thu Aug 01 19:13:14 2019 +0100
+++ b/libInit.cc	Wed Jul 08 11:26:45 2020 +0100
@@ -16,31 +16,47 @@
 DLL_EXPORT void _libstx_goodies_cypress_InitDefinition() INIT_TEXT_SECTION;
 #endif
 
-void _libstx_goodies_cypress_InitDefinition(pass, __pRT__, snd)
-OBJ snd; struct __vmData__ *__pRT__; {
-__BEGIN_PACKAGE2__("libstx_goodies_cypress__DFN", _libstx_goodies_cypress_InitDefinition, "stx:goodies/cypress");
-_stx_137goodies_137cypress_Init(pass,__pRT__,snd);
+extern void _CypressAbstractReaderWriter_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ressJSONReader_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ressModel_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_stx_137goodies_137cypress_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ressAbstractReader_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ressAbstractWriter_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ressClass_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ressMethod_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ressPackage_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ressRepository_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ressFileTreeReader_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ressReader_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+extern void _CypressWriter_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
 
-__END_PACKAGE__();
+extern void _stx_137goodies_137cypress_extensions_Init(int pass, struct __vmData__ *__pRT__, OBJ snd);
+
+void _libstx_goodies_cypress_InitDefinition(int pass, struct __vmData__ *__pRT__, OBJ snd)
+{
+  __BEGIN_PACKAGE2__("libstx_goodies_cypress__DFN", _libstx_goodies_cypress_InitDefinition, "stx:goodies/cypress");
+    _stx_137goodies_137cypress_Init(pass,__pRT__,snd);
+
+  __END_PACKAGE__();
 }
 
-void _libstx_goodies_cypress_Init(pass, __pRT__, snd)
-OBJ snd; struct __vmData__ *__pRT__; {
-__BEGIN_PACKAGE2__("libstx_goodies_cypress", _libstx_goodies_cypress_Init, "stx:goodies/cypress");
-_CypressAbstractReaderWriter_Init(pass,__pRT__,snd);
-_CypressJSONReader_Init(pass,__pRT__,snd);
-_CypressModel_Init(pass,__pRT__,snd);
-_stx_137goodies_137cypress_Init(pass,__pRT__,snd);
-_CypressAbstractReader_Init(pass,__pRT__,snd);
-_CypressAbstractWriter_Init(pass,__pRT__,snd);
-_CypressClass_Init(pass,__pRT__,snd);
-_CypressMethod_Init(pass,__pRT__,snd);
-_CypressPackage_Init(pass,__pRT__,snd);
-_CypressRepository_Init(pass,__pRT__,snd);
-_CypressFileTreeReader_Init(pass,__pRT__,snd);
-_CypressReader_Init(pass,__pRT__,snd);
-_CypressWriter_Init(pass,__pRT__,snd);
+void _libstx_goodies_cypress_Init(int pass, struct __vmData__ *__pRT__, OBJ snd)
+{
+  __BEGIN_PACKAGE2__("libstx_goodies_cypress", _libstx_goodies_cypress_Init, "stx:goodies/cypress");
+    _CypressAbstractReaderWriter_Init(pass,__pRT__,snd);
+    _CypressJSONReader_Init(pass,__pRT__,snd);
+    _CypressModel_Init(pass,__pRT__,snd);
+    _stx_137goodies_137cypress_Init(pass,__pRT__,snd);
+    _CypressAbstractReader_Init(pass,__pRT__,snd);
+    _CypressAbstractWriter_Init(pass,__pRT__,snd);
+    _CypressClass_Init(pass,__pRT__,snd);
+    _CypressMethod_Init(pass,__pRT__,snd);
+    _CypressPackage_Init(pass,__pRT__,snd);
+    _CypressRepository_Init(pass,__pRT__,snd);
+    _CypressFileTreeReader_Init(pass,__pRT__,snd);
+    _CypressReader_Init(pass,__pRT__,snd);
+    _CypressWriter_Init(pass,__pRT__,snd);
 
-_stx_137goodies_137cypress_extensions_Init(pass,__pRT__,snd);
-__END_PACKAGE__();
+    _stx_137goodies_137cypress_extensions_Init(pass,__pRT__,snd);
+  __END_PACKAGE__();
 }